Life as a Wheel

Life is like a wheel...
Sometimes you're up, sometimes you're down
At times you feel like your going around in circles
Doing the same old routine every single day
Life can also get wear and tear
A scratch and some dirt
A few bumps on the road
Maybe even a nail.
We get punctured, then sealed
And we're good to go again.

Life's like that...

Mine has absolutely nothing exciting going on.
I'm a wheel stuck in the mud
While all the other wheels are passing me by...
Stuck and alone with no one to push me

Maybe, just maybe, given the right push
And the right set of mind,
I can go again.

But I'm too deep in the mud
Feeling too down to move
I'm starting to give up hope
Maybe I'll be stuck here forever...

When the frown turns upside down...

I'm happy to share that I am feeling much better now. I still think about him, but that's normal..part of the process..a stage..

He, meanwhile, has completely vanished into thin air from my life... What can I do? Nothing, of course. I am not one to mess with fate--if it's not meant to be, then so be it.

I have found healing in the most unusual place: work and kids.

As an ESL teacher, it's not hard to be amused by young innocent kids who usually make mistakes using their newly acquired English words.  Take for example my 12-year-old boy student who recently learned the words: garage, hangar, and depot, to name a few.

Last week, the students had their vocabulary test wherein they had to use their words in grammatically correct sentences. When the test papers were returned to us, the teachers, I couldn't help but giggle when I saw what my student wrote:

"My mother HANGAR my t-shirt." 

Good job, my student... good job for making me laugh lifting my downtrodden spirit. ^_^


Also, my 10-year-old girls surprisingly became really close to me. Playfully joking around with me, playing catch with me, telling me stories and even hugging me after the day is over!

Curiouser and curiouser....

Life seriously never fails to mystify me...
